Showdown Series Raises $66,000 For Feeding South Dakota

The Fourth Annual South Dakota Showdown series presented by South Dakota Corn is now complete. South Dakota Corn Growers Marketing and legislative Director Teddi Mueller says the money raised to help Feeding South Dakota was an increase of $44,000 from last year’s event.

SDSU won this year’s series over the University of South Dakota by a score of 16 to 11. Mueller says while the competition is fun, what’s really important is how everyone came together to help the less fortunate.

Mueller says when they started the event four years ago, everyone, the two Universities and South Dakota Corn were all committed to helping feed the hungry and assisting Feeding South Dakota.

Feeding South Dakota is the state’s hunger relief organization fighting to eliminate hunger in the state. The group provides temporary food assistance to 21,000 hungry South Dakota families and individuals each week.
